    So what you are saying, asking, is you purchased a Photoshop subscription @ the original offering price of $19.99 a month cost (or whatever it was) and now what to Drop that in favor of the PS CC + Lightroom $9.99 subscription. Is that correct?
    If so you have two options as I see it.
    1) do as suggested above and contact Customer Care to see if you can switch over before the end of the original subscription.
    2) If you are close to the end of that original subscription period wait for it to end, Do Not Renew and then sign up for the newer lower cost PS CC + LR subscription.

  • Can I buy multiple single app purchases?

    It's more economical for me to buy 2 single app purchases, than paying to access the full suite monthly (at the cancel any-time rate)
    Is this even possible though?

    http://www.adobe.com/products/creativecloud/faq.html#purchasing-availability
    Can I buy more than one membership to an individual offering of Creative Cloud?
    No, Adobe has moved to identity-based licensing with a technology that will not support multiple same-product licenses, so you can buy only one membership per Adobe ID. If you need two Creative Cloud memberships, you will need to purchase each with a unique Adobe ID. You can also purchase a Creative Cloud for teams membership, which allows you to purchase and manage multiple seats under one account.
    So you can buy a Photoshop Single App and a Illustrator Single App membership using the same Adobe ID
    but not 2 x Photoshop Single App or 2 x individual Cloud memberships with the same Adobe ID.
